Output 10c3c8ff6780174f6cc070b152ad6728fa80efcd144abc31cdef54e564341578:1

value
150513191
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c1209655e399fcb6f6994fef71c3b3900b13c94 OP_EQUALVERIFY OP_CHECKSIG
address
17wDxntcxcUoC8nF2CMP6qFmp1CQSjFXDY
transaction
10c3c8ff6780174f6cc070b152ad6728fa80efcd144abc31cdef54e564341578
confirmations
472515
spent
true